The QualCert Level 1 Diploma in Civil Technology is an introductory qualification designed to build a strong foundation for individuals interested in the world of construction and civil engineering. It provides a clear understanding of how civil structures are planned, developed, and maintained, making it an excellent starting point for those who want to explore the technical side of the construction industry. This course is ideal for beginners who are eager to understand how real-world infrastructure projects come to life.

The programme covers essential topics such as basic construction principles, introduction to building materials, site safety awareness, surveying fundamentals, and an overview of civil engineering tools and techniques. Learners gain a simple yet structured understanding of how construction projects are executed and how different components work together to create safe and durable structures.   • Age requirements: Learners must be at least 16 years old at the time of enrollment.
  • Educational background: Applicants should have completed secondary education or its equivalent, with a focus on subjects such as mathematics, science, or technology being beneficial.
  • Professional experience: While prior work experience in construction or engineering is not mandatory, any exposure to technical or vocational environments will be considered an advantage.
  • Language proficiency: Learners must demonstrate adequate English language skills to follow instructions, complete assessments, and engage in guided learning hours effectively.

Mandatory Units

  • Introduction to Civil Technology and Construction Industry
  • Basic Construction Materials and Their Uses
  • Site Safety and Health Awareness
  • Tools, Equipment, and Basic Handling Techniques
  • Fundamentals of Building Construction Processes
  • Introduction to Site Practices and Work Procedures
